Mike Flynn recognized with SIA/SRC University Research Award

Mike Flynn, the Fawwaz T. Ulaby Collegiate Professor of Electrical and Computer Engineering (ECE), has been awarded the Semiconductor Industry Association (SIA)/Semiconductor Research Corporation (SRC) University Research Award for Design. Minghui (Scott) Zhao Received 2nd Place in ACM Student Research Competition (SRC) at MobiCom ’24

Minghui (Scott) Zhao, a third-year PhD student in our lab, won second place in the Student Research Competition at the 30th ACM International Conference on Mobile Computing and Networking (MobiCom’24) held in Washington, DC. The award recognizes his team’s work on connecting foundation models with the physical world through reconfigurable drone systems.
